Vacuum Pumps Market Analysis

ID: MRFR//10188-CR | 194 Pages | Author: Snehal Singh| April 2024

The market dynamics of the vacuum pumps industry are influenced by various factors that impact its growth, trends, and challenges. Vacuum pumps play a crucial role across a wide range of applications, including manufacturing, pharmaceuticals, semiconductors, and automotive industries. One of the primary drivers of this market is the increasing demand for vacuum pumps in manufacturing processes, such as vacuum packaging, degassing, and vacuum forming, to ensure product quality and operational efficiency. As manufacturing sectors continue to expand globally, the demand for vacuum pumps rises accordingly, driving market growth.

 

Technological advancements are key factors shaping the dynamics of the vacuum pumps market. The development of innovative vacuum pump technologies, such as dry vacuum pumps, oil-free vacuum pumps, and variable speed pumps, improves efficiency, reliability, and environmental sustainability. These advancements address the industry's evolving needs for energy-efficient and eco-friendly vacuum solutions, driving market demand. Additionally, the integration of digital technologies, such as IoT-enabled monitoring and predictive maintenance systems, enhances the performance and lifespan of vacuum pumps, further influencing market dynamics by reducing downtime and operational costs.

 

Market dynamics are also influenced by regulatory frameworks and environmental considerations. Governments worldwide are implementing regulations aimed at reducing greenhouse gas emissions and promoting energy efficiency in industrial processes. This drives the adoption of environmentally friendly vacuum pump technologies that minimize emissions and energy consumption, such as oil-free and dry vacuum pumps. Furthermore, increasing awareness of environmental sustainability among industries and consumers encourages the adoption of eco-friendly vacuum pump solutions, shaping market dynamics by driving demand for green technologies.

 

Economic factors, including industrialization, manufacturing output, and investment in infrastructure, play a significant role in shaping the dynamics of the vacuum pumps market. Economic growth in emerging markets, particularly in Asia-Pacific and Latin America, drives demand for vacuum pumps in various industries, such as electronics manufacturing, chemicals, and food processing. Additionally, investments in infrastructure projects, such as wastewater treatment plants, power plants, and semiconductor fabs, boost the demand for vacuum pumps for vacuum-based processes and applications, driving market growth.

 

Market dynamics are further influenced by industry-specific trends and developments. For example, in the semiconductor industry, the increasing demand for vacuum pumps is driven by the growing adoption of vacuum-based processes in semiconductor manufacturing, such as chemical vapor deposition (CVD) and physical vapor deposition (PVD). Similarly, in the pharmaceutical industry, stringent regulations regarding product quality and safety drive the demand for vacuum pumps for processes such as vacuum drying, freeze-drying, and distillation.

 

Competition and market consolidation also shape the dynamics of the vacuum pumps market. The industry is characterized by the presence of several key players, including Atlas Copco, Gardner Denver, Pfeiffer Vacuum Technology AG, and Busch Vacuum Solutions, among others. Market players compete based on factors such as product quality, performance, pricing, and after-sales services to gain a competitive edge. Additionally, mergers, acquisitions, and strategic partnerships among key players contribute to market consolidation and influence market dynamics by expanding product portfolios, geographic reach, and technological capabilities.

 

In conclusion, the market dynamics of the vacuum pumps industry are shaped by a combination of factors, including technological advancements, regulatory frameworks, economic conditions, industry-specific trends, and competitive dynamics. As industries continue to evolve and demand efficient and environmentally friendly vacuum solutions, the market for vacuum pumps is expected to witness steady growth, driven by the ongoing innovation and adaptation to meet evolving industry needs.

Global Vacuum Pump Market Overview


Vacuum Pump Market Size was valued at USD 5,131.60 million in 2022. The Vacuum Pump Market industry is projected to grow from USD 5,309.15 million in 2023 to USD 8,184.80 million by 2032,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.93% during the forecast period (2023 - 2032). The Vacuum Pump Market is experiencing robust growth and is poised for further expansion in the coming years. The market is witnessing increasing demand from various end-use industries such as oil and gas, chemical, semiconductor manufacturing, and healthcare, driving its impressive growth trajectory. Key factors fuelling this market growth include the growing need for efficient vacuum solutions in industrial processes, rising investments in research and development activities, and a surge in demand for vacuum pumps in the healthcare sector for applications like medical devices and diagnostics. Additionally, the escalating adoption of vacuum pumps in emerging economies to support industrialization and infrastructure development is further bolstering market growth.

Vacuum Pump Market Trends




  • Growing Demand For Vacuum Pumps In The Food And Beverage Industry




The Vacuum Pump Market has experienced significant growth in recent years, driven by various industries seeking efficient and reliable vacuum solutions. Among these industries, the food and beverage sector stand out as one of the key drivers propelling the expansion of the market. Vacuum pumps play a crucial role in multiple processes within the food and beverage industry, contributing to improved food quality, longer shelf life, and enhanced packaging techniques. One of the primary reasons for the escalating demand for vacuum pumps in the food and beverage industry is their indispensable role in vacuum packaging and preservation. Vacuum packaging involves removing air from the package before sealing it, creating an oxygen-free environment that significantly reduces the risk of bacterial growth and food spoilage. Vacuum pumps aid in this process by efficiently removing air from the packaging material, extending the shelf life of perishable food items like meat, dairy products, and fresh produce. Additionally, vacuum packaging prevents the oxidation of food, preserving its nutritional value and ensuring a higher quality product for consumers.


Beyond packaging and preservation, vacuum pumps are instrumental in various food processing and manufacturing applications. In the production of certain food products, such as cheese and chocolates, vacuum pumps are used to degas ingredients, removing unwanted air bubbles, and ensuring a smooth texture and consistent quality. Moreover, vacuum pumps facilitate the concentration of flavors and aromas by reducing the pressure in the production process, intensifying the taste of the final product. These advantages have led food manufacturers to integrate vacuum pump technologies into their production lines, enhancing the overall product quality and consumer satisfaction. Vacuum cooling is a rapidly growing application in the food and beverage industry, and vacuum pumps play a pivotal role in this process. Vacuum cooling involves the rapid removal of heat from fresh produce immediately after harvest, extending its shelf life and preserving its nutritional content. Vacuum pumps enable the fast extraction of air and water vapor from the produce, causing rapid evaporative cooling. This method offers several advantages over traditional cooling methods, such as reduced energy consumption, shorter processing times, and minimized product weight loss. As sustainability and resource efficiency become more critical concerns for the industry, the adoption of vacuum cooling systems with vacuum pumps continues to rise. Food safety is a paramount concern in the food and beverage industry, and vacuum pumps contribute significantly to meeting the stringent standards set by regulatory authorities. By eliminating air and sealing food products tightly, vacuum packaging creates a barrier against external contaminants, preventing bacterial growth and cross-contamination. This ensures that consumers receive food products with the highest safety standards, free from harmful pathogens. Additionally, vacuum pumps' ability to remove oxygen reduces the risk of spoilage and the formation of mold, ensuring that food remains fresh and safe throughout its shelf life.

Global Vacuum Pump Based on Mechanism Segment Insights


Based on mechanism, the vacuum pump market has segmented into gas transfer and gas binding. Gas transfer segment held the largest market share (57.43%) in 2022. Gas transfer vacuum pumps operate by mechanically transferring gases from one location to another, creating a partial vacuum. In this segment, several mechanisms are utilized, including rotary vane pumps, which employ rotating vanes to compress gases and transfer them. Rotary piston pumps use rotating pistons, suitable for higher vacuum levels. Diaphragm pumps feature a flexible diaphragm to create a vacuum, offering oil-free operation for applications where contamination must be minimized. Scroll pumps use interleaved scrolls to compress and transfer gases, ensuring quiet and oil-free operation.


Global Vacuum Pump Based on pump type Segment Insights


Based on pump type, the vacuum pump market has segmented into positive displacement (liquid ring, rotary screw, rotary root), dry vacuum (dry screw, dry scroll, dry diaphragm, dry clan & hook, and others), centrifugal, momentum transfer (rotary vane and turbo molecular) and regenerative application. Positive displacement segment held the largest market share (23.16%) in 2022. Positive displacement vacuum pumps operate by trapping gas inside a pumping chamber and then reducing the volume to create a vacuum. This category includes several types, each with distinct characteristics: Liquid Ring Vacuum Pumps: Liquid ring vacuum pumps use a liquid, typically water, to create a rotating ring inside the pump. The liquid serves as the sealing and compressing medium, allowing for effective handling of liquids and vapor. These pumps are commonly used in wet applications, such as chemical processing, refineries, and wastewater treatment. Rotary Screw Vacuum Pumps: Rotary screw vacuum pumps utilize two or more intermeshing screws to compress gas and create a vacuum. As the screws rotate, they trap and move gas from the inlet to the exhaust. These pumps are known for their efficiency, reliability, and continuous vacuum generation, making them suitable for industrial applications like packaging and food processing. Rotary Roots (Roots Blower) Vacuum Pumps: Roots pumps consist of two rotating lobe-shaped rotors that trap and transfer gas. They are frequently used as booster pumps in combination with other primary pumps to enhance overall system efficiency. Roots pumps find application in various industrial processes, including vacuum systems for chemical industries and power generation.

Global Vacuum Pump Based on Lubrication Segment Insights


Based on lubrication, the vacuum pump market has segmented into dry vacuum and wet vacuum. The wet vacuum segment held the largest market share (75.05%) in 2022. Wet vacuum pumps, in contrast to dry vacuum pumps, require a working fluid, typically oil, for lubrication and sealing within the pumping chamber. The working fluid creates a seal between moving parts, allowing for efficient gas compression and transfer. These pumps are commonly used in applications where oil contamination is not a concern, and a higher vacuum level is required, such as chemical processing, food packaging, and vacuum furnaces. Wet vacuum pumps offer advantages like high pumping speeds and the ability to handle a wide range of gas loads. The most common types of wet vacuum pumps include oil-sealed rotary vane pumps and oil-sealed rotary piston pumps. While wet vacuum pumps provide reliable performance, they require periodic maintenance and careful monitoring of oil levels and quality to ensure optimal operation and prevent oil contamination in sensitive applications.


Global Vacuum Pump Based on Pressure Segment Insights


Based on pressure, the vacuum pump market has segmented into rough vacuum pumps (10.3 mbar-1 mbar), medium vacuum (pumps 1 mbar-10-3 mbar), high vacuum pumps (10-3mbar-10-7 mbar), ultra-high vacuum pumps (10-7 mbar-10-12 mbar) and extreme high vacuum pumps (less than 10-12 mbar). ultra-high vacuum pumps (10-7 mbar-10-12 mbar) segment held the largest market share (26.93%) in 2022. Ultra-high vacuum pumps operate in the pressure range of 10-7 mbar to 10-12 mbar and are used for applications demanding extremely low levels of residual gas. These pumps are crucial for scientific research, surface analysis, electron microscopy, and advanced semiconductor manufacturing. Common types of ultra-high vacuum pumps include cryogenic pumps, ion pumps, and sputter ion pumps. Cryogenic pumps operate at extremely low temperatures to capture and condense gas molecules. Ion pumps and sputter ion pumps use electrically charged ions to remove gas molecules from the vacuum chamber. Ultra-high vacuum pumps create an environment with minimal gas interference, allowing for highly precise measurements, imaging, and analysis in scientific and industrial research.

Global Vacuum Pump Based on Application Industry Segment Insights


Based on application, the vacuum pump market has segmented into assembly, conveying, engine testing, dehydration/ drying, filling, evaporation & distillation, manufacturing, holding/ chucking, material handling, thermoforming, and others. Evaporation & Distillation segment held the largest market share (13.77%) in 2022. Vacuum pumps are integral to evaporation and distillation processes, where they lower the pressure inside a system to facilitate the removal of volatile solvents or distillates. These processes are commonly used in chemical, pharmaceutical, and petrochemical industries for purification and separation of substances. Vacuum pumps enable efficient and precise control over evaporation rates and distillation temperatures, making them essential in achieving desired product qualities.


Global Vacuum Pump Based on Regional Segment Insights


By Region, the study provides market insights into North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, Middle East & Africa, and South America. The Asia-Pacific Vacuum Pump market accounted for largest market share of 37.12% in 2022 and is expected to exhibit a significant CAGR growth of 5.47% during the study period. This growth can be attributed to various factors, including the rise of small-scale vacuum pump manufacturers in developing nations, collaboration with OEMs from different countries to produce cost-effective pumps, and a higher demand for retrofitting compared to new installations. Furthermore, the expanding applications of vacuum pumps in various industries, such as the chemical, manufacturing, food, and beverage, pharmaceutical, and electronics sectors, are driving the market's expansion.  In recent years, there has been a notable surge in the number of small-scale vacuum pump manufacturers setting up shops in developing countries. These manufacturers often collaborate with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EMs) from other nations to produce affordable vacuum pumps for use in different end-user sectors. As vacuum pumps are already essential components in production machinery across numerous industries, there is a significant demand for retrofitting existing systems, further driving the market growth.

The oil and gas industry plays a crucial role in driving the demand for vacuum pumps in North America. The region is home to abundant oil reserves, with a significant portion found in Canada's oil sands. According to Natural Resource Canada, 97% of Canada's proven oil reserves are located in the oil sands, presenting immense opportunities for vacuum pump manufacturers. Moreover, leading oil producers like ExxonMobil have announced plans to expand production activities in regions like the West Texas Permian Basin, further boosting the demand for vacuum pumps.
